History Channel "Histories Mysteries" "The Real Dracula"

01:39 Feb 01 2008
Times Read: 728


The History channel has a show where they scientifically describe the typical symptoms of a vampire and how villager a thousand years ago may have assumed the dead came back to life.



The show discusses the decomposition of the corpse and things like:

- fingernails, hair and teeth look like they grow after death due to the dehydration and retraction of flesh, making look like the body may still be alive and growing and the teeth look elongated.

- gasses from decomposition tend to bloat the body, making it look well fed.

- juices tend to exit out of the body at various places, including the mouth, which look like the corpse had been drinking blood.



If someone died soon after another death, the villager could well exhume the body to find these types of things and assume the body was a vampire.
